The 25-year-old withdrew from the match in March due to injury and is now getting ready for the Euro 2024 qualifying matches against Malta and North Macedonia.


Although Rashford has had to withdraw from other camps over the years, controversy erupted when he chose to fly to New York while England was winning their Group C opening 2-1 in Italy.


The 51-cap striker's decision to fly to the United States at the time was backed by manager Gareth Southgate, and the Manchester United forward claims he was undeterred by criticism.


To be really honest with you, Rashford said, "I didn't see it. When I went home, I noticed it.


"I took a quick trip for four days and then returned to do rehab because I needed time to unwind and recover."


When asked if it bothered him that people questioned his dedication to representing his nation, Rashford said, "Honestly, it doesn't.


"I know that even though I'm fully dedicated to it, people will say what they're going to say. I'm not very bothered about it.

As a relentless campaign finally comes to an end, Rashford is now entirely focused on global issues.


During an unusual campaign that featured the World Cup in Qatar sandwiched in the midst, he made 61 appearances for club and country.


This number might increase to 63 if he participates in the qualifier on Monday at Old Trafford against North Macedonia and Malta, which is just 23 days before United's first preseason game.


When questioned whether it was necessary to look at the calendar, Rashford responded, "I believe that's apparent.


It's absurd that from November until we were eliminated from the Europa League, we competed against teams that only played once a week at the club level.
